6-Day Adventurous Journey to Leh Ladakh

Thursday, September 7: Arrive in Leh

Start your adventurous journey by arriving in Leh, the capital of Ladakh. In the morning, acclimatize to the high altitude and explore the local market, where you can find traditional handicrafts and souvenirs. In the afternoon, visit the Leh Palace, a nine-story royal residence offering panoramic views of the city. As the evening approaches, witness the stunning sunset from Shanti Stupa, a Buddhist white-domed monument.

  • Leh Market: Estimated Cost - Free, Estimated Time Spent - 2 hours
  • Leh Palace: Estimated Cost - ₹250 ($3.5) per person, Estimated Time Spent - 1 hour
  • Shanti Stupa: Estimated Cost - Free, Estimated Time Spent - 1 hour
Friday, September 8: Nubra Valley

Embark on a thrilling journey to Nubra Valley. In the morning, drive through the world's highest motorable pass, Khardung La, and enjoy breathtaking views of the snow-capped mountains. Reach Nubra Valley and visit the Diskit Monastery, where you can witness the 106-foot tall statue of Maitreya Buddha. In the afternoon, experience the unique double-humped Bactrian camels during a camel safari in the sand dunes of Hunder. Spend the evening stargazing and camping in the enchanting beauty of Nubra Valley.

  • Khardung La: Estimated Cost - Free, Estimated Time Spent - 1 hour
  • Diskit Monastery: Estimated Cost - ₹30 ($0.4) per person, Estimated Time Spent - 1 hour
  • Hunder Camel Safari: Estimated Cost - ₹500 ($7) per person, Estimated Time Spent - 2 hours
Saturday, September 9: Pangong Tso Lake

Head towards the mesmerizing Pangong Tso Lake, known for its ever-changing shades of blue. In the morning, drive through the scenic Chang La pass, the third-highest motorable pass in the world. Reach Pangong Tso Lake and spend the afternoon exploring the lakeshore, taking in the breathtaking beauty and serene atmosphere. Enjoy a peaceful evening camping by the lake, under the starlit sky.

  • Chang La Pass: Estimated Cost - Free, Estimated Time Spent - 1 hour
  • Pangong Tso Lake: Estimated Cost - Free, Estimated Time Spent - 3 hours
Sunday, September 10: Hemis National Park

Discover the wildlife and natural beauty of Hemis National Park, one of the largest national parks in South Asia. In the morning, embark on a thrilling wildlife safari, where you may spot rare Himalayan species like snow leopards, Tibetan wolves, and golden eagles. Explore the park's picturesque trails in the afternoon, surrounded by stunning landscapes and diverse flora and fauna. Spend the evening relaxing and immersing yourself in the tranquility of nature.

  • Wildlife Safari: Estimated Cost - ₹800 ($11) per person, Estimated Time Spent - 3 hours
  • Hiking Trails in Hemis National Park: Estimated Cost - Free, Estimated Time Spent - 2 hours
Monday, September 11: Magnetic Hill and Alchi Monastery

Experience the intriguing Magnetic Hill phenomenon and delve into the cultural heritage of Alchi Monastery. In the morning, visit the Magnetic Hill, where the surrounding landscape creates an optical illusion of a vehicle moving uphill against gravity. In the afternoon, explore the ancient Alchi Monastery, known for its exquisite wall paintings and unique architectural style. Spend the evening capturing the picturesque views of the Indus River and surrounding mountains.

  • Magnetic Hill: Estimated Cost - Free, Estimated Time Spent - 1 hour
  • Alchi Monastery: Estimated Cost - ₹50 ($0.7) per person, Estimated Time Spent - 2 hours
Tuesday, September 12: Tso Moriri Lake

Conclude your adventurous journey with a visit to the stunning Tso Moriri Lake. In the morning, drive through scenic landscapes and cross the Chumathang hot springs. Reach Tso Moriri Lake and spend the afternoon exploring the serene surroundings, offering a perfect blend of tranquility and natural beauty. Witness the captivating sunset over the lake and spend the evening camping by its shores, cherishing the memories of your adventure.

  • Chumathang Hot Springs: Estimated Cost - Free, Estimated Time Spent - 1 hour
  • Tso Moriri Lake: Estimated Cost - Free, Estimated Time Spent - 3 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For adventure enthusiasts, Leh Ladakh offers numerous off the beaten path attractions. Explore the Zanskar Valley, renowned for its challenging treks and breathtaking landscapes. Visit the Lamayuru Monastery, known as the "Moonland" due to its lunar-like terrain. For adrenaline-pumping experiences, indulge in river rafting along the Zanskar or Indus River. The Leh-Manali Highway offers a thrilling road trip with stunning vistas. Don't miss the local cuisine, try traditional Ladakhi dishes like momos, thukpa, and butter tea.
